REPOSITIONING A PATIENT

The employee was helping to reposition a patient who was agitated. The EE was holding the patients hand because they were attempting to pull out their nasograstric tube. The patient also tried to bite the employee and bent their fingers back. Then th

Sprained Right Finger(s) Struck by patient PATIENT
